U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T MIDDLE DISTRICT OF LOUISIANA NELSON T. LOPEZ (#615051) CIVIL ACTION VERSUS NO. 18-509-JWD-RLB JAMES LEBLANC, ET AL. OPINION After independently reviewing the entire record in this case and for the reasons set forth m the Magistrate Judge's Report (Doc. 35) dated February 19, 2020, to which no objection was filed; IT IS ORDERED that the plaintiffs claims against defendant Becky Meredith are dismissed, without prejudice, for failure of the plaintiff to serve the defendants as required by Federal Rule of Civil Procedure 4(m).
